Anne-Sophie Schaltegger (ETH Zürich) — "A social and cultural perspective on
interdisciplinary and transdisciplinary research assessment: learning from
three Swiss funding schemes"
Research assessment mechanisms are still considered one of the main barriers
to interdisciplinary and transdisciplinary research (IDR/TDR). Particularly
in the funding domain, criteria and processes used to evaluate the quality
of IDR/TDR proposals, or to monitor the progress of funded IDR/TDR projects,
create biases against collaborative, boundary-spanning research. To be able
to develop adequate solutions, more knowledge is needed about the current
lived realities and experiences of actors involved in IDR/TDR assessment:
panel members, funding officers, and the researchers themselves. In this
seminar, I present insights from my ethnographic study of ten assessment
panels and implicated funding officers and researchers in three Swiss
IDR/TDR funding schemes. I will outline three main findings: 1) the need to
acknowledge and leverage – rather than to reduce – the conceptual and
epistemic diversity in assessment panels, 2) the potential of scaffolding
IDR/TDR assessment as a relational, social process, and 3) the opportunity
of using assessment itself as a resource for all involved actors in the
challenging endeavour of making IDR/TDR happen successfully.
Hussein Zeidan (Vrije Universiteit Amsterdam) — "From slogan to practice:
Restoring transdisciplinarity as a serious way of working"
Transdisciplinarity is increasingly celebrated as a pathway to better
science, yet its growing visibility masks persistent conceptual ambiguity
and a widening gap between rhetoric and practice. While publications often
present it in optimistic terms, the real frustrations surface informally, in
the hallway conversations where scholars acknowledge the tensions,
contradictions, and institutional pressures shaping their work. In this
contribution, I surface these underlying tensions and question how
Pop-Transdisciplinarity have taken hold. I invite us to reconsider what we
expect transdisciplinarity to achieve, how it operates in practice, and how
it intersects with other approaches to societal and epistemic challenges. I
aim to move beyond superficial claims toward a more honest, ethically
grounded, and rigorous engagement, one that confronts transdisciplinarity's
blind spots and situates it within broader debates on knowledge, power, and
the moral responsibilities of science.

This session of the AFIRE Experimental Funders Group will examine Distributed Peer Review (DPR) — a reciprocal model where applicants themselves participate in the review process.
The event features speakers Jessica Biddinger (American Heart Foundation), Svenja Vandertol (NWO), Tom Stafford and Stephen Pinfield (VWS), and Sampsa Kaataja (NordForsk) sharing insights from their organizations' implementation of DPR.
The discussion will address key questions including: What types of funding calls suit DPR? How should funders communicate DPR to applicants? When should it be used, and when shouldn't it?
Institutionally organized research funding emerged in the early 20th century, with significant expansion during and after World War II in the US. This sparked the adoption of project-based peer-reviewed research funding across Western systems, though at varying rates. Current criticisms focus on fairness issues, high costs, and questionable validity.
The seminar discusses emerging alternatives, including lottery-based approaches. While random funding distribution faces skepticism, tiebreaker lotteries among peer-reviewed proposals have gained more acceptance. The speaker proposes a lottery-first approach, in which a lottery determines who is eligible to submit a full proposal, presenting empirical data on fairness, costs, and satisfaction.
The talk concludes by examining why funding systems resist change despite criticisms and what functions beyond merit selection may explain this persistence.

The scientific enterprise, as a human profession, is not immune to error. Several failsafe mechanisms (e.g., peer review) exist to catch mistakes before publication, but errors still routinely make it through.
ERROR is a comprehensive program to systematically detect, report, and prevent errors in scientific publications, modelled after bug bounty programs in the technology industry. Reviewers are paid for finding substantive flaws in published work.

Many research questions about the effect of an intervention are unlikely to be answered with a randomised trial and decision-makers may then rely on observational data. However, as everyone knows, correlation does not always indicate causation. The target trial framework provides a principled way to design observational studies to reduce the risk of common biases introduced by study design.
